Diagnostic characters
Pronoutm without suprahumeral horns. Forewing with 2 m-cu crossveins, without s crossvein.
Immatures
McKamey and Wallner (2022b) described and illustrated the nymphs. The eggs are deposited within plants.
Ecology
Not attended by ants, the nymphs are remarkably cryptic on their host plants (McKamey and Wallner 2022b).
Behavior
The nymphs are solitary (McKamey and Wallner 2022b).
